What is the Cabárceno de Cantabria Nature Park?
Located in the Pisueña valley, municipality of Penagos, and only 15 km from the Cantabrian capital, this park is an ideal destination if you are visiting Santander with the family because since last September 1, boys and girls up to ten years old can enter for free.
Located in an old opencast iron mining operation that closed at the end of the 1980s, the Cabárceno Nature Park covers some 750 hectares of land. Those reddish lands in the foothills of Peña Cabarga, which at times seem to transport us to USA, are now home to more than 150 species of animals from around the world. Tigers, elephants, zebras, buffalo, gorillas, birds of prey, giraffes… In this natural area, a spectacular karst landscape which has become home to all of them.
In addition to the remains of the abandoned iron mine, during the route through the enclosure we will see animals of all kinds in its more than 20 kilometers of internal roads. You can stop at different points along the route and even organize a picnic in the park. Is a ideal excursion to do in one day which, moreover, is pet-friendly and allows us to go with our pets in the car and walking through the park.
In addition to the route through the safari park, there are exhibitions of birds of prey (included in the price of admission), a reptile park and attractions such as the famous funicular or cable car. East park plan It will give you all the clues of the possible stops to make.
Cabárceno cable car
The Cabárceno Nature Park cable car is 6 kilometers long and has two lines, with the duration of the complete journey (on both lines) being around 50 minutes.
The tour has four stations located at strategic points in the parkStation 1 in Cabárceno next to the East access, Station 2 next to the Mirador de Rubí in the North area of the park, Station 3 next to the bear enclosure in its northern part and Station 4 next to the South access through Sobarzo to the park.

Hours of the Cabárceno Nature Park
The park is open all year except on December 24, 25 and 31 and January 1, and has different hours depending on the season. The timetable is for entry, since you can stay in the Park until sunset, but we are going to tell you when the ticket offices close:
- From 03/01 to 11/01 open from 9:30 a.m. to 6:00 p.m.
- From 11/02 to 02/28 (Monday to Friday) from 9:30 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.
- From 11/02 to 02/28 (Saturdays, Sundays, holidays and long weekends) from 9:30 a.m. to 6:00 p.m.
- Holy Week (from Holy Thursday to Easter Sunday) from 9:00 a.m. to 6:00 p.m.
The cable car has different schedulesand the last upload is 30 minutes before it closes:
- June, September, long weekends and every weekend of the year: open from 10am to 6pm.
- July and August: open from 10am to 7pm.
- March, April, May and October: open from 10:30 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.
- November, December, January and February: open a single line, Monday to Friday, from 11am to 5pm.
- Holy Week: from April 9 to 13, open from 9:30 a.m. to 6:30 p.m.; from April 14 to 17, open from 9:00 a.m. to 6:30 p.m.
Tickets for the Cabárceno Nature Park
Tickets for the Cabárceno Nature Park are priced from 20 euros for adults in low season (from 07/11 to 31/03, except bridges and holidays) and 10 euros for the youth ticket for children from 11 to 16 years old.
The price in medium-high season (from 04/01 to 11/06 except from 07/15 to 08/31, and Monday, Tuesday and Wednesday of Easter, in addition to all bridges and holidays) amounts to 32 euros per adult and 18 euros by children.
Furthermore, there is a friend of the park card that allows you to go as many times as you want throughout the year and that has a price from 64 euros for adults from 18 years old. If we want a family card, there are three options: the Mono card (86 euros for an adult and children up to 17 years old), the Family card (for parents and children up to 17 years old with a price of 150 euros) and the Manada card, with a price of 182 euros and is valid for parents and children up to 17 years old and two grandparents.
More activities in Cabarceno
In addition to the normal ticket, Cabárceno offers experiences like “Wild Visit”, a different way of getting to know the park in a vehicle together with experts and getting much closer to the animals and their way of life. Includes food and an exclusive route. The price is from 230 euros per adult and 115 euros per child.
One of our favorites is “Cabárceno en EBike”, a bike route in groups of a maximum of seven people, with which we will do sports without realizing it (as with these sports that do not give laziness) and has a price of 65 euros for adults and 50 euros for children from 9 to 12 years old.
